CougFan.com: Washington State EDGEÂ Will Rodgers IIIÂ entered the transfer portal Monday morning, 247’s Chris Hummer reported. Rodgers, a 6-4, 249-pound senior out of Saginaw, Mich., started at one of the EDGE spots in the opener against Oregon State and played in both games this season.
Rodgers ranked No. 12 on the Cougar defense with 73 total snaps in two games, posting a 56.2 grade for the season on Pro Football Focus College.
